dc.description | Holograph letter from P.J. Roughneen, Kiltimagh (County Mayo), to Hagan. Passing on information gathered in Liverpool from a Dr. Cavanagh, former student at the English College Rome: it is common property that Hagan would not be appointed for the British government's opposition to him, for his own delicate health, and that Hagan would be appointed representative or legate of Irish bishops. Adding that [the metropolitans of] Liverpool and Westminster had been opposed to the appointment of Dr. Hinsley and that they are more of one mind than is suspected. | |
